This is a relocation role in Greater Manchester.

IntSol Recruitment is partnering with one of the UK’s largest bus operators to recruit experienced Bus Drivers for full-time, long-term positions across the country.

This is an excellent relocation opportunity for qualified PCV licence holders looking for guaranteed hours, competitive pay rates, and either free accommodation or a generous relocation package.

How to prepare for a job interview at IntSol Recruitment

Know Your Routes

Familiarise yourself with the bus routes in Greater Manchester. Being able to discuss specific routes and your understanding of the area will show your enthusiasm and readiness for the role.

Highlight Your Experience

If you have previous driving experience, especially with a PCV licence, make sure to share relevant stories. Talk about how you've handled challenging situations on the road or provided excellent customer service.

Ask About Training Opportunities

Show your eagerness to learn by asking about training and development opportunities. This demonstrates that you're committed to growing within the company and improving your skills as a driver.

Prepare for Practical Questions

Expect questions about safety protocols and how you would handle various scenarios while driving. Practising your responses to these types of questions can help you feel more confident during the interview.
